javascript 图像在 Bootstrap 3 中的跨度内居中

Centering a javascript image inside a span in Bootstrap 3

我遇到了一个问题,我必须将两个安全封条放在响应式付款表单底部的中央,其中一个工作正常,但另一个包含标签的工作不正常

<div class="container">
  <div class="row text-center">
    <div class="footer">
      <div class="col-md-12  col-sm-12" >
        <script type="text/javascript" src="https://sealserver.trustwave.com/seal.js?code=<?= $this->model->getTWKey() ?>"></script>
      </div>

      <div class="col-md-12 col-sm-12" >
        <span id="cdSiteSeal2" >          
          <script type="text/javascript" src="//tracedseals.starfieldtech.com/siteseal/get?scriptId=cdSiteSeal2&amp;cdSealType=Seal2&amp;sealId=55e4ye7y7mb73952743bf753a95b7cfvma3y7mb7355e4ye734fda9346a2ed18a"></script>
        </span>
      </div>
    </div>
  </div>
</div>

您可以看到页面here。我尝试了几种不同的方法(即偏移和创建居中 class ala)

.img-center {margin:0 auto;}

但是没有任何效果。

由于第一个 javascript 小部件中心很好,我只能得出结论,它正在做一些事情来阻止它工作。

我很确定我这样做的方式不完全正确,但我是后端开发人员而不是 UI 设计师,我只是想为我的客户提供一些东西。

通过检查 javascript 插入的元素,您可以看到需要居中的是 div,而不是图像。

尝试添加此 CSS 规则:

#siteSealFauxBadge > div { 
    margin: 0 auto;
}

添加css

#siteSealFauxBadge div:first-child {
margin: 0 auto;
}

你会得到如图所示的结果